Adolfo López Mateos was a Mexican politician who served as President of Mexico from 1958 to 1964. Previously, he served as Secretary of Labor and Social Welfare from 1952 to 1957 and a Senator from the State of Mexico from 1946 to 1952. Wikipedia
Born: May 26, 1910, Ciudad López Mateos, Mexico
Died: September 22, 1969 (age 59 years), Mexico City, Mexico
Presidential term: December 1, 1958 – November 30, 1964
Spouse: Angelina Gutiérrez (m. 1965–1969) and Eva Sámano (m. 1937)
Children: Eva Leonor López-Mateos Sámano
Organizations founded: Institute for Social Security and Services for State Workers, World Boxing Council, National Commission of Free Textbooks, and more
